Border Leicester

Founded:
1767
 Northumberland, England
 George and Mathew Culley


Mature weight:
Ewes: 175lbs-275lbs
 Rams: 225lbs-325lbs


Know for it’s long, lustrous wool

Cheviot



Founded:
 As Early as 1372
 Cheviot Hills on broader of England
and Scotland
Mature weight:
 Ewes: 120lbs-160lbs
 Rams: 160lbs-200lbs
Known for it’s long wool type, white wool
free face and black feet and muzzle

Corriedale

Founded:
Late 1800’s
 Australia and New Zealand


Mature weight:
Ewes: 130lbs-180lbs
 Rams: 175lbs-275lbs


Known as a duel purpose bred with
good carcass quality

Suffolk

Founded:
1810
 English breed


Mature weight:
Ewe: 180lbs-250lbs
 Ram: 250lbs-350lbs


Known for its meatiness and
quality of wool
